AI Summary
-
Amends Connecticut General Statutes Section 7-148(c)(10) to allow municipalities to prescribe increased penalties for repeated violations of ordinances within a one-year period.
-
Permits municipalities to impose penalties up to $500 for a repeated violation of the same ordinance that results in issuance of a subsequent citation, compared to the standard maximum of $250 for first violations.
-
Allows municipal officers to enforce regulations and ordinances through written citations, provided regulations are specifically designated for citation enforcement and a written warning is issued before citation (except for dirt bike, all-terrain vehicle, and mini-motorcycle operation violations).
-
Takes effect October 1, 2018.
Legislative Description
An Act Concerning The Imposition Of Penalties For Repeated Violations Of Municipal Regulations And Ordinances.
